You’ll Need a Pro for Some Things

Unless you are a licensed electrician or plumber, understand that there are some tasks that will require outside help. You can still do some of the work on your own, of course, but there are just some things that you need to let a professional handle.

You Might Save Money – Or Not

Many people who choose the DIY route do so to save money. There’s nothing wrong with that and, in some cases, it will happen. However, it’s important to realize that once you dig in, you might actually need more work than you thought.

By hiring a professional from the beginning, most of these things will be known. And even if a pro doesn’t discover them until they dig into the remodel, they know how to address unexpected issues. You might not, which could end up costing you much more than you might save.

Time Is Valuable

Remodels take time, and it’s likely to take you much longer to do on your own. This is not necessarily an issue if you have another bathroom to use in the meantime. However, if you’re remodeling your only bathroom or your water needs to be cut off for the work, it can become an issue. A professional can usually finish the task much quicker.
